Church Road 1 Single Vineyard Merlot 2019 750ml

Church Road One is a range of single vineyard wines that typify the character and personality of our best winegrowing sites. Great Merlot has feeling of weight and plushness on the palate whilst retaining fruit freshness and vibrancy. A hard grape to grow and make well, Merlot performs to the highest standard in only a handful of viticultural regions around the globe. One of those regions is Hawke's Bay where it excels in our moderate climate, when grown with care and respect on the right soil types.

Craggy Range Aroha Pinot Noir 750ml

Aroha is a romantic word in the Ma0ori language of New Zealand meaning love. Reflective of its namesake, Aroha is handcrafted with passion from two unique parcels of Pinot Noir, including one of the legendary Abel clone. The fruit is grown on a slope of an elevate terrace of fertile land at the Te Muna Road vineyard where an ancient dried river bed delivered nutrient rich soil perfect for growing Pinot Noir. A traditional burgundy in colour with a soft crimson hue. The palate is lively and pure, focusing towards a red fruit core, whilst the tannins are prevalent but balanced. The concentration of flavour is high as a result of the low yield. Plenty of personality in a wine that will continue to soften with age.
